It turns out the rumors were true! Your Vogue magazine April 2013 cover girl is none other than our *majestic* First Lady Michelle Obama!
Whispers that the FLOTUS might once again grace the cover of the fashion bible started swirling back in January, when Annie Leibovitz (who lensed the spread) and Vogue‘s camera crew were spotted at the White House.

Ms. Obama last appeared on the cover for the magazine’s March 2009 issue in a magenta Jason Wu frock.
This time around, she’s wearing a dress from one of her favorite designers, Reed Krakoff. Of course, she looks amazing in both.
